Output ffd768828f253e77ded3513ea89e8850d78ee31596e6b2a21018bd2bf2baad2d:1

value
330521
script pubkey
OP_HASH160 OP_PUSHBYTES_20 541bafabdbdd804b84b0e376237dd2f4ff512240 OP_EQUAL
address
39MjrL4ncjqQWvF6CXgRuFQ4pnVUZB71tZ
transaction
ffd768828f253e77ded3513ea89e8850d78ee31596e6b2a21018bd2bf2baad2d
confirmations
303186
spent
true